Analysis of the High Temperature Electrical Properties of Wustite

Abstract
A model is proposed to interpret the electrical conductivity and the Seebeck coefficient of wüstite. The methods for evaluating the concentration of charge carriers as a function of temperature and oxygen partial pressure were developed earlier from an analysis of thermogravimetric data. A hopping type mechanism of conduction is assumed. Thus, the mobility of the charge carriers is proportional to the jump probability which is assumed to be influenced by two factors. These are a blocking factor, which renders a fraction of the sites neighboring a charge carrier unavailable for occupancy, and a self‐screening parameter which partially negates the blocking.
